Quick and dirty new analysis, in response to complaints about the "eyeball" method of ranking

Substituting all 4.5's for the two samples in which means are not shown, I quickly came up with the following graph for the overall results, using ANOVA / Fisher LSD instead of the "eyeball" ranking method:

http://ff123.net/export/aac.png

The rankings are about the same as before, with QT the clear winner, FAAC the clear loser, and the rest tied. However, this method has the advantage of showing how close the codecs are to the reference score of 5.0

In a future test, I recommend using an anchor (filtered version of the original) to put things in better perspective.

1) Any speculation as to why ATrain and Layla were so easy for AAC? Surely they were chosen because the samples were challenging to MP3, Ogg and MPC. (I'm guessng the next test will address issues of what samples are handled relatively better or worse by the codecs.)


Atrain has relatively low perceptual entropy, making it easy to encode at 128 kbps for AAC - also, most passages are "noisy" which gives more masking abilities for the psych model.  Same goes for layla (noisy)

Quote
4.  You mention that you used an ANOVA analysis, but maybe you should also mention that this is different from what the 64 kbit/s test used.  The similar presentation format might make people think that all the analysis was identical.  The difference is mainly one about risk.  The ANOVA / Fisher LSD method is more at risk for falsely identifying differences between codecs.  On the other hand, it's more sensitive than the Tukey HSD.


Addressed

XM is probably using gear from Thales
http://www.thales-bm.com/
Probably this baby.
It's the same gear most DRM stations are using.

Thales uses AAC encoder from FhG and SBR encoder from CT. Probably  integerized versions.
